The following are a few binary classification applications, where the 0 and 1 columns are two possible classes for each observation: Quick example WebDefinition: Encoders (or binary encoders) are the combinational circuits that are used to change the applied input signal into a coded format at the output. These digital circuits come under the category of medium scale integrated circuit. Basically, these are used to minimize the number of data lines as well as to code the input data.

In statistics, binary data is a statistical data type consisting of categorical data that can take exactly two possible values, such as "A" and "B", or "heads" and "tails". It is also called dichotomous data, and an older term is quantal data. The two values are often referred to generically as "success" and "failure".
